WebA support group for those caring for someone with dementia - whether they are living at home or in an aged care facility. The group meets twice a month for a relaxed and informal discussion and support session and sometimes guest speakers are invited to talk. The Dementia Carers Support Group is run by Springwood Neighbourhood Centre. WebAll support groups are facilitated by trained individuals. Many locations offer specialized groups for children, individuals with younger-onset and early-stage Alzheimer's, adult caregivers and others with specific needs. Support groups are held virtually or in person, please see your local listing for details.
